Napoletana Tomato Sauce Pizza

Discover the essence of Neapolitan pizza with this Napoletana Tomato Sauce recipe. Simplistic yet flavorful, this sauce epitomizes the Neapolitan tradition of using only the finest San Marzano tomatoes and sea salt. The magic of this sauce lies in its thin consistency, allowing the natural flavors of the tomatoes to shine through, harmonizing with the pizza dough perfectly. For those seeking a touch of sweetness and intensity, a dash of high-quality ground tomatoes can be added without breaking the AVPN rules. So, let’s embark on a culinary journey to Naples, as we master the art of making Napoletana Tomato Sauce, the heart and soul of authentic Neapolitan pizza.

 

INGREDIENTS:

  • 2 (28-ounce/795-gram) cans San Marzano tomatoes, preferably Strianese
  • Fine sea salt

 

PREPARATIONS:

  1. Follow the instructions for hand-crushed tomatoes on this page, but leave the cleaned tomatoes in large pieces and save the strained tomato juice in the bowl under the strainer.
  2. Set up a food mill with a fine screen and place it over a clean bowl.
  3. Work the tomatoes through the food mill, scraping the bottom of the screen with a rubber spatula when you are done.
  4. You should have about 1⅓ cups (340 grams) of tomato sauce. Check the thickness; it should be on the thin side.
  5. If the sauce seems too thick, stir in a bit of the reserved juice.
  6. Season the sauce with a little salt.
  7. The sauce can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days.

 

YIELD:

  • About 1⅓ cups (340 grams) of sauce, enough for 3 Napoletana pizzas

 

SPECIAL INSTRUCTIONS:

  • Use great San Marzano tomatoes for the best results.
  • Adjust the sauce thickness by adding some reserved tomato juice if necessary.

 

TIPS:

  • For a slightly sweeter and more intense sauce, consider adding a small amount of high-quality ground tomatoes.

 

In our journey to uncover the essence of Neapolitan pizza, we encountered the heart and soul of its flavor—the Napoletana Tomato Sauce. With just two ingredients—San Marzano tomatoes and fine sea salt—this sauce showcases the brilliance of simplicity. An integral part of Neapolitan pizza tradition, this sauce brings out the best in the pizza dough, creating a harmonious symphony of flavors that tantalize our taste buds.

The secret to the Napoletana Tomato Sauce lies in the choice of San Marzano tomatoes. Sought after for their rich flavor and low acidity, these tomatoes elevate the sauce to new heights. As we hand-crush and pass them through the food mill, we preserve their essence, ensuring a thin consistency that allows the pizza dough to shine through, beckoning us to indulge in the true essence of Naples.

With utmost ease, the sauce graces your table for multiple pizza feasts. Store it in the refrigerator, ready to be called upon whenever the craving for Neapolitan pizza strikes. Allow the aroma of Napoli’s culinary heritage to fill your home, as the sauce works its magic on each pizza creation.

In the spirit of Neapolitan pizza-making, a final touch awaits you just before baking. A pinch of sea salt sprinkled over the fully assembled pie elevates the flavors to new heights.
